Choose Fresh Ingredients
For the best experience, opt for fresh vegetables. Crisp cucumbers and ripe tomatoes in your salad will add crunch and juiciness, enhancing overall flavor. Fresh herbs like parsley and mint can elevate your salad, infusing it with aromatic notes that are quintessential to Mediterranean cuisine.
Bean Variety Matters
Using a mix of beans not only adds texture but also provides a range of nutrients. Canned beans are convenient—just rinse them before adding to the salad. However, if you have time, consider cooking dried beans from scratch for a heartier taste.
Dressing Dynamics
Your Mediterranean Bean Salad Recipe’s dressing is crucial; it can make or break the dish. A simple combination of ol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, and a pinch of salt enhances the salad’s natural flavors. Don’t shy away from adjusting the acidity to your taste—some love a zesty punch while others prefer a milder finish.
Chill for Best Results
Allowing your salad to chill for at least an hour gives the flavors time to meld. It’s like a mini-vacation in the fridge for your ingredients, resulting in a salad that is both refreshing and savory.

How long does the salad last in the fridge?
The delightful flavors of your Mediterranean Bean Salad can last in the refrigerator for about 3 to 5 days. To preserve its fresh taste and texture, store it in an airtight container. If you notice the veggies losing their crunch or the salad becoming a bit soggy, consider enjoying it sooner rather than later, as freshness truly enhances its appeal.
Can I use other beans instead of chickpeas?
Absolutely! While chickpeas are a star ingredient in this Mediterranean Bean Salad Recipe, feel free to mix it up. Black beans, kidney beans, or even white beans can be delicious substitutions. Just make sure to rinse and drain canned beans well to eliminate excess sodium and any tin flavor.
Is this salad vegetarian and gluten-free?
Yes! The beauty of the Mediterranean Bean Salad Recipe lies in its versatility as a vegetarian dish, making it perfect for meat-free meals. Additionally, since it primarily consists of beans, fresh vegetables, and olive oil, it is naturally gluten-free. Always double-check dressing labels if you’re using store-bought, as some may contain gluten-based additives.

Mediterranean Bean Salad
- Total Time: 15 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A fresh, crisp, and flavorful Mediterranean bean salad that combines chickpeas, colorful bell peppers, and a tangy lemon dressing.
Ingredients
- 1 can (15 oz) canned chickpeas (rinsed and drained)
- 1/2 cup diced bell peppers (preferably red or yellow for color)
- 1/4 cup finely chopped red onion (soaked in cold water for 10 minutes to soften)
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
- 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ice (preferably freshly squeezed)
- 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
- 1/4 teaspoon salt (to taste)
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per (freshly ground)
- 1/4 cup sliced Kalamata olives (pitted)
Instructions
- Drain and rinse the canned chickpeas thoroughly in a colander to remove excess salt and canning liquid. Set aside.
- Finely chop the red onion and soak it in cold water for about 10 minutes to soften and reduce pungency. Drain well.
- Dice the bell peppers into small, colorful pieces and chop the fresh parsley finely. Slice the Kalamata olives if they aren’t already sliced.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the rinsed chickpeas, diced bell peppers, softened red onion, chopped parsley, and sliced olives. Gently toss to distribute all ingredients evenly.
- In a small bowl or jar, whisk together the freshly squeezed lemon juice, olive oil, salt, and black pepper until well combined. This creates a bright, tangy dressing.
- Pour the dressing over the bean and vegetable mixture. Toss gently to coat all the ingredients thoroughly without mashing the beans.
- Let the salad sit at room temperature for about 10 minutes to allow the flavors to meld, or refrigerate for up to 2 hours for an even more refreshing taste.
- Give the salad one last gentle toss before serving.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ed, adding more lemon juice or salt for brightness.
- Serve the Mediterranean Bean Salad at room temperature or chilled, garnished with extra herbs if desired. Enjoy this fresh, crisp, and flavorful dish!
Notes
- This salad can be made in advance and stored in the refrigerator for up to 2 hours.
- Add additional herbs for garnish, such as cilantro or dill, if desired.
